The Akureyri Art Museum is another cool spot. It has both modern and traditional art from Icelandic artists. Itโ€™s a chance to see creative and interesting artworks.

If you love history, head to the Akureyri Museum. It shows the town’s development over the years. You can see old artifacts and learn about Akureyri’s cultural growth.

Want to learn about Icelandic sagas? Visit Nonni’s House. This museum is dedicated to Nonni, a famous Icelandic children’s book author. You’ll see his books and learn how his work influenced Icelandic culture.

Sample Traditional Icelandic Dishes

Dish Description
Brennivรญn A traditional Icelandic schnapps made from fermented potato mash and flavored with caraway seeds.
Plokkfiskur A comforting dish made with boiled fish, mashed potatoes, and flavored with onions and spices.
Rรบgbrauรฐ A dense and moist rye bread, traditionally baked in geothermal ovens. It pairs perfectly with butter, smoked fish, or pickled herring.
Kleinur A traditional Icelandic pastry resembling a twisted doughnut, often flavored with cardamom and fried to perfection.
